Contents:
Introduction: Neo-Latin literature / Victoria Moul -- Ideas and assumptions. Conjuring with the classics: Neo-Latin poets and their pagan familiars / Yasmin Haskell -- Neo-Latin literature and the vernacular / Tom Deneire -- How the young man should study Latin poetry: Neo-Latin literature and early modern education / Sarah Knight -- The Republic of Letters: across Europe and beyond / Françoise Waquet -- Poetry and drama. Epigram / Robert Cummings -- Elegy / L. B. T. Houghton -- Lyric / Julia Haig Gaisser -- Verse letters / Gesine Manuwald -- Verse satire / Sari Kivistö -- Pastoral / Estelle Haan -- Didactic poetry / Victoria Moul -- Epic / Paul Gwynne -- Drama / Nigel Griffin -- Prose. Approaching Neo-Latin prose as literature / Terence Tunberg -- Epistolary writing / Jacqueline Glomski -- Oratory and declamation / Marc van der Poel -- Dialogue / Virginia Cox -- Shorter prose fiction / David Marsh -- Longer prose fiction / Stefan Tilg -- Prose satire / Joel Relihan -- Historiography / Felix Mundt -- Working with Neo-Latin literature. Using manuscripts and early printed books / Craig Kallendorf -- Editing Neo-Latin literature / Keith Sidwell.
